Hello everyone. My mini 4 pro had fallen from 30 meters to short grass ground. Surprisingly for me, there are no broken parts on the outside, just a few small scratches. So I was happy for a moment.

Here is the problem, when the rc controller is close to the drone (10-15 cm), the connection is really unstable. It just connects and disconnects randomly, and I don’t get full 4 bars of signal. When I am 3-4 steps away from the drone with the controller, the connection is a little better, 3-4 bars mostly.

I showed it to a guy who repairs dji drones and he said something like “it might be the rf module and if it is, you should just buy a new drone”. also there is a camera lens error and he said it’s probably the ptz cable.

I don't have money to buy a new one or get it fixed in the service right now, so I'm trying to understand the situation at least. what do you think might be the issue? thanks for reading.

The Motherboards for those run about 100 dollars IF YOU CAN FIND THE PART! (sorry but good luck really)
Because your Drone was in a crash, you may simply have dislodged or torn a cable. However it will cost you at least the money for those components to check...and if the problem was a broken solder joint then you will have wasted the cash. If you can do it cheaply you may try replacing the cables It has a chance of being the fix But my money is on a board replacement because of the ground impact. DJI Drones flake solder when they crash!
